Gender-based violence is violence directed against a person because of their gender. Gender-based violence and violence against women are terms that are often used interchangeably as it has been widely acknowledged that most gender-based violence is inflicted on women and girls, by men.

GBV occurs as a result of normative role expectations and unequal power relationships between genders in society. Patriarchal power structures dominate in many societies, in which male leadership is seen as the norm, and men hold the majority of power.
